Automatic Dependent Surveillance-Broadcasts (ADS-B) is the one of used technology for improving aviation safety that ADSB technology is used to control the flight transmitting information about flight states especially flight identity periodically transmitted. Microstrip patch antenna is designed to receive ADSB frequency that frequency resonates at 1.09 GHz. Microstrip patch antenna substrate is Epoxy (FR4), substrate dielectric constant (εr) is about 4.4, substrate thickness is 1.6 mm and substrate lost tangent is 0.02. Microstrip patch antenna Substrate dimension designed for ADS-B receiver is 137x130 mm, patch antenna dimension is 73x65 mm and inset feeder length is 5 mm. Simulation result is 1.1560 for its VSWR at minimum frequency 1.096 GHz. For measurement result, VSWR is 1.0933 at 1.096 GHz. Acording to simulation and measurement result, Microstrip antenna is proper to used for ADS-B receiver antenna alternating Indonesian Airport.
